Digital Training Delivery Methods Corporate training delivery methods that leverage digital tools come under this category. Below is a list of extremely popular digital training delivery methods that maximize penetration, outreach, and impact by being interactive, engaging, and accessible. Interactive eBooks eBooks can deliver media-rich, responsive, and customized content through digital publication platforms. They can be downloaded in PDF formats or viewed straight through the resource using simple mobile applications, making them accessible and easy to use. They are cost-effective for the organizations as well. Digital publishing platforms like Hurix KITABOO allow for the simple creation and distribution of eBooks easily to a whole network of learners without much hassle. Videos Creating engaging, information-rich videos is another way of delivering corporate training to employees. They can be engaging and educational when created with the right length and information load. Videos enhance retention and information recall. However, they are resource-intensive, making them a hefty investment. AR/VR Enhanced Digital Content Augmented and virtual reality corporate training modules are a highly impactful, interactive, and engaging method of training delivery. They help create solo experiences for the learner, which help increase the returns from the training. However, these technologies are expensive and may be too much of an investment at this point. Learning Management Systems LMS is the most effective and efficient of all the digital methods to deliver corporate training to a large number of employees at once. LMS is centralized and can be accessed with a user ID and password. This allows L&D professionals to upload their training modules to the system and allow employees to access them at their convenience. They are cloud-based, accessible, and extremely function-rich. Microlearning Microlearning refers to bite-sized training content which is highly focused on a contextual subject that can be digitally broadcasted over the employee network. It can be a short piece of video, an infographic, a short PPT, a text, or even a flyer-sized digital asset that employees can quickly read and learn from. Mobile Content The only device every employee is guaranteed to always have on their person is the mobile phone. Creating corporate training content that is mobile-friendly helps to ensure its penetration stays high. At the same time, it allows the employees time to pace their training (as the content remains accessible on mobile phones. They can consume it whenever they get time). Julia Suk March 2, 2023 No Comments

A Complete Guide to Leadership Training and Development

[vc_row][vc_column][vc_column_text]Leadership is an essential aspect of any organization, and having effective leaders is crucial to the success of any business. While some professionals have natural leadership qualities, leadership training and development can help every professional enhance their leadership skills. To this end, this article provides a complete guide to leadership training and development, including the objectives of leadership training, the importance of leadership training, and various types of leadership training programs. Leadership Training Objectives The primary leadership training objective is to help individuals become better leaders by developing their leadership skills. The objectives of leadership training may vary depending on the organization and the specific needs of its leaders.  Some common objectives of leadership training include: Developing Communication Skills: Effective communication is a critical aspect of leadership. Leadership training and development programs often focus on developing communication skills, such as active listening, effective speaking, and nonverbal communication. Enhancing Decision-Making Skills: Leaders are often required to make important decisions that can impact the success of an organization. Leadership training programs can help individuals develop critical thinking and decision-making skills. Building Teamwork Skills: Leaders must work collaboratively with their teams to achieve organizational goals. Training programs can help individuals develop teamwork skills, such as building trust, effective delegation, and conflict resolution. Developing Strategic Thinking Skills: Leaders must be able to think strategically and create long-term plans for their organizations. Through leadership training programs, they can boost their strategic thinking skills, such as setting goals, designing plans, and implementing strategies. Enhancing Time Management Skills: Effective time management is a critical aspect of leadership. Leadership training programs can help individuals develop time management skills, such as prioritizing tasks, setting goals, and managing their time effectively. Types of Leadership Training Programs Several types of leadership training and development programs are available, each with its unique focus and approach. Some of the most common types of leadership training programs include: 1. Executive Leadership Development Programs Executive leadership development programs are designed for senior executives and top-level managers. These programs focus on developing high-level leadership skills, such as strategic thinking, decision-making, and change management. They are typically delivered through in-person training sessions, coaching, and mentoring. 2. Managerial Leadership Development Programs Managerial leadership development programs are designed for mid-level managers and supervisors. These programs focus on developing communication, delegation, team-building, and performance management skills. They are typically delivered through in-person or online training sessions, coaching, and mentoring. 3. Team Leadership Development Programs Team leadership development programs are designed for project managers and team leads. These programs focus on developing skills such as collaboration, conflict resolution, and effective decision-making. They are typically delivered through in-person or online training sessions, group exercises, and role-playing scenarios. 4. Leadership Coaching Leadership coaching is a one-on-one program designed to help individuals develop their leadership skills. Coaches work with individuals to identify their strengths and weaknesses and develop customized plans to improve their leadership skills. Coaching sessions can be held remotely or face-to-face. 5. Online Leadership Development Programs Online leadership training and development programs provide self-paced training to individuals. These programs may include webinars, online courses, and virtual coaching sessions. They are ideal for individuals who cannot attend in-person training sessions or prefer to learn at their own pace. 6. In-person Leadership Workshops In-person leadership workshops are designed to provide hands-on training to individuals. These workshops may include group exercises, role-playing scenarios, and interactive discussions. They are an ideal option for individuals who prefer a more interactive learning experience. 7. To help your organization keep up with the trend in digital learning, we’ve listed below some of the best online corporate training delivery methods. 7 Popular Online Training Delivery Formats for the Virtual Work Environment 1. Virtual Instructor-led Training (VILT) Unlike a traditional classroom, virtual instructor-led training (VILT) connects learners and instructors via a virtual space. Despite being in different locations, attendees can get trained at the same time through webinars and conferencing software.   In today’s new world of remote learning, VILT is a real boon. It offers great flexibility and convenience to learners regarding how and where they learn. As there are no hospitality or travel expenses involved, VILT helps in reducing training costs. It can also be combined with collaborative tools like roleplay and discussion boards to keep the human touch intact. 2. eLearning eLearning is one of the most widely-used training methods delivered via an online learning management system (LMS) or a corporate learning portal. It is known for creating better engagement, personalized learning experiences, and retention than traditional training. The global eLearning market was worth over $315 billion in 2021 and has an expected comp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 20% from 2022 to 2028. From games, prerecorded videos, and blogs to slideshows, quizzes, and voiceovers, eLearning offers all that it takes to make the content more engaging and interactive for the employees. While instructors can track each employee’s training progress, employees have the flexibility to learn at their own pace.   3. Social Media-based Learning Model What can be better than social media to reach a wider audience? The ever-growing power of social media is indisputable. It’s no wonder that L&D teams are using social media platforms like Twitter, Facebook, and Instagram as a new training delivery method. The training content is broken down into smaller episodes, each personalized to meet specific training goals. Such training programs promote collaboration and teamwork. If social media is an integral part of your organization, then this learning model can enhance your staff’s familiarity with essential internal and external methods of communication.    4. Video Training Video modules have been used by educators for decades. But training videos, in today’s high-tech world, are more engaging and accessible than ever before. Many corporations believe that video learning is an effective way to engage employees. After all, who doesn’t like graphics-based delivery? In addition to interesting visuals and storytelling, videos also offer great versatility. They are not restricted to learn-by-example scenarios anymore. Video training now offers first-person style narratives or “choose your own adventure.” They allow employees to navigate their learning according to their knowledge and seek feedback directly from experts when required.     5. Microlearning Microlearning videos are one of the most popular online training delivery formats. Most adults have an attention span of around 8 to 10 minutes. Here’s where microlearning comes in handy.    This method breaks down the learning content into shorter topics or sections using videos. Each video revolves around a single topic, thereby making it easier for learners to effectively retain information. It also offers them great flexibility as they are not required to complete the session in one go. Learners can schedule one-on-one sessions from their living room or a café whenever they are willing to.   6. Blended Learning Blended learning is an excellent combination of high-tech eLearning and traditional face-to-face classroom training. This method engages both traditional learners and learners who are comfortable with computer-based training. It also enables employees to learn in their leisure time, playing videos, games, tutorials, and quizzes from their tablet, laptop, or smartphone. Another advantage of this method is that it enables trainers to assign scenario-based or skill-building tasks outside the classroom. This gives them an opportunity to prepare for the class and receive feedback from their trainers and peers.    7. Mobile Learning As the name suggests, mobile learning or mLearning includes content that is optimized to be displayed on smartphones or mobile devices. We live in a dynamic workplace where the needs of remote learners must be catered to, and mobile learning is one of the best ways to go. Popularly known as “learning on the go,” it is a self-paced digital training available to learners across multiple mobile devices (smartphones/tablets). This enables employees to access the required content from the comfort of their homes. Gamification  Gamification is an online training delivery method becoming increasingly popular in recent years. It uses game design elements and mechanics to make learning more engaging and enjoyable.  Gamification learning involves integrating game-like mechanisms like a points system, badges for certain achievements, leaderboards to encourage competition, and progress bars into the learning process. It is highly effective in promoting active participation and motivation among learners. The key advantage of Gamification is that it helps learners to retain information better. In addition, it allows learners to apply what they have learned in real-world scenarios, making the learning experience more practical and meaningful.  This method is especially useful in complex topics where learners must apply problem-solving skills to master the subject. Pros Promoters have higher levels of engagement, competition, and motivation when compared to traditional training methods.  It has been known to improve knowledge retention by at least 40%. It allows learners to retain information better by applying what they have learned in real-world scenarios. Training by Gamification gives instant feedback on one’s understanding of a specific subject.  Cons Some learners may find the game-like elements too juvenile or unsuitable for serious learning. Microlearning  Microlearning is another popular online training delivery method that delivers information in concise learning modules. It involves breaking down complex topics into smaller and more manageable pieces of information. Microlearning is highly effective in providing quick and efficient learning on the go.  Probably the biggest advantage of microlearning is that it allows anyone to learn at their complex topics at their own pace and at their convenience. Microlearning also allows learners to focus on specific areas of interest and fill knowledge gaps quickly.  This makes it highly suitable for busy professionals who do not have the luxury of time.  Pros Microlearning provides concise learning modules that learners can complete quickly. It enables learners to focus on specific areas of interest and fill knowledge gaps rapidly. It allows learners to learn at their own pace and convenience. It is suitable for busy professionals who have limited time for learning. Cons It may not provide learners with the context or background information to fully understand the topic. Virtual Reality Virtual Reality (VR) has been around for a while but is the latest online training delivery method that has recently gained popularity in the professional training niche. It involves creating a simulated environment that mimics real-world scenarios to provide an immersive learning experience. In addition,  The primary advantage of VR is that it provides a safe and controlled environment for learners to practice complex tasks that may be too risky to learn on the job. It allows learners to gain hands-on experience in a safe and simulated environment.  Pros VR provides an immersive learning experience that mimics real-world scenarios. It allows learners to gain hands-on experience in a safe and controlled environment. It is suitable for complex tasks and procedures that require hands-on experience. Cons VR technology can be expensive and may require specialized hardware and software. Adaptive Learning  Adaptive learning is a game changer when it comes to smart and efficient online training delivery methods. It uses AI and machine learning algorithms to personalize the learning experience for learners based on individual needs.   Adaptive learning archives this by collecting data on the learners’ performance and adjusting the learning content to suit their learning needs best. As a result, it is highly effective in providing personalized and targeted learning to learners. Adaptive learning is great for identifying knowledge gaps in the workforce and providing tailored training to each individual to fill those gaps, which will lead to better training and an equally skilled workforce.  Pros Adaptive learning personalizes the learning experience for each learner. It enables learners to learn at their own pace resulting in a more effective training experience. It is suitable for learners with different learning abilities and styles. Cons It may not be suitable for learners who prefer a more structured approach to learning. Mobile Learning  Mobile learning is an online training method that uses mobile devices such as smartphones and tablets to deliver learning content. It involves creating learning materials optimized for mobile devices that can be accessed anytime, anywhere.  As a result, mobile learning is highly effective in providing flexible and convenient training to professionals who are always strapped for time.  The essential advantage of mobile learning is that it enables learners to learn on the go. Furthermore, it allows learners to access learning materials anywhere, whether traveling or working.  Pros It allows learners to learn on the go, anywhere, and anytime. It enables learners to access learning materials on their preferred devices. Cons Mobile devices may have limitations in terms of screen size and processing power.
